We hit Keaton beach two weekends ago. Did a bunch of drifts around and beyond the racks and ran down to big grass key also. Tough fishing for sure, we got three trout all keepers, one Spanish, a few under size black sea bass, and cut off a few times by sharks. We re-rigged for shark and a big one came around and was too much for the line. Oh and caught my first cobia, undersized of course. Was a slow but ok day.

Last Tuesday, I fished in the vicinity of Yamaha reef with some friends. We fished for about half an hour before the thunderstorms chased us back to shore. However, in that short time period, we caught and released a nice red snapper, an amber jack, a small red grouper, and a nurse shark. When we were just a few miles off of the Dog Island, we tried fishing over live bottom/rocks. We caught a few miniature seabass, a keeper flounder, and a big white grunt.

Fishing all the time, it’s August and hot. Some days are okay some are not. Redfish are spread out everywhere and hard to nail down. Run and gun can be good right now but you have to catch them feeding otherwise you are just burning fuel.
